For Sale: NEw! ApowerII heavy duty power supply for the 500,600,1200 ![]() There are 0 Available. Here are the specs: ------------------ 7 COLORED Slow changing power LED. Much smaller than the original C= psu. Beige in color! Works on any voltage from any country 100vac to 240vac. 50 or 60hz. Much more powerful than the original power supply (7AMPS on +5v,1.0Amp on +12v,.1amp on -12v). +5v @1Amp DC jack for Plipbox Power(plip power cord included) Uses a standard IEC power cord from any printer or computer(Not Included!). Completely quiet and no fans. Neon lighted power switch - know when its on or off,unlike the original! Light is not obnoxious in a dark room. Overload Protected - Auto reset when overload is cleared up. Short Protected - Goes into a pulse mode until the short is fixed.Auto reset when short is fixed. These are intended for desktop machines only, NOT towered machines with zorro/pci expansions!
